D
Dan Ewart Review of Moonstep
I recently discovered this company and I must say,...
I recently discovered this company and I must say, I'm impressed. The website is easy to navigate and their customer support team is very helpful. I had a minor issue with my order, but they resolved it quickly. I would definitely recommend Moonstep!

Comments: